Half key limiting device for guide vane rotating arm of water turbine
By designing supports and limiting bolts to fix the split key on the turbine guide vane swing arm, the problems of misalignment and floating of the split key were solved, the turbine was stabilized, and the reliability of force couple transmission and the operational stability of the unit were improved.

TECHNICAL FIELD
[0001] The utility model belongs to the technical field of hydraulic turbine, especially relates to a hydraulic turbine guide vane rotating arm half key limiting device. BACKGROUND
[0002] The half key of the guide vane rotating arm is used for transmitting force couple, when the force couple generated by the force transmitter acts on the control ring, it is transmitted to the guide vane rotating arm through double connecting rods, and finally transmitted to the guide vane by the half key. The installation standard of the half key of the guide vane rotating arm is that the joint of the half key is perpendicular to the shearing direction, that is, the joint surface passes through the guide vane shaft plane. During the action of the water guide mechanism, the half key may be dislocated and float up due to insufficient machining precision, uneven stress, vibration and impact. During the operation of the hydro-generator unit, when the half key is dislocated to be parallel to the shearing direction, the force couple cannot be transmitted to the guide vane, so that the guide vane cannot operate; when the half key floats up during the operation of the unit, the guide vane cannot rotate when the half key floats up to a certain amount. The above two conditions will cause the unit to stop and the guide vane to be unable to be closed, so that the unit cannot be stopped, which seriously endangers the operation of the unit. CONTENT OF THE UTILITY MODEL
[0003] In view of the above problems of the half key during the operation of the hydraulic turbine, the utility model provides a half key limiting device for the guide vane rotating arm of the hydraulic turbine, which improves the stability of the half key during the operation of the hydraulic turbine.
[0004] The utility model is realized through the following technical schemes:
[0005] A half key limiting device for the guide vane rotating arm of a hydraulic turbine, comprising a support, support bolts and limiting bolts; the half key is installed on the upper part of the guide vane rotating arm through a guide vane rotating arm end cover.
[0006] The support is cylindrical and internally hollow and is sleeved on the outside of the half key, the bottom of the support is provided with connecting ears on both sides, the connecting ears are connected with the guide vane rotating arm end cover through the support bolts, and the top of the support is provided with bolt holes for threadedly connecting the limiting bolts.
[0007] The working principle of the utility model is as follows:
[0008] After the support is sleeved on the outside of the half key, the support is fixed with the guide vane rotating arm end cover by using the support bolts to pass through the connecting ears arranged at the bottom of the support, the inside of the support is internally hollow and reserved for the half key enough operation space, then the limiting bolts are screwed into the inside of the support from the bolt holes at the top of the support, so that the limiting bolts abut against the top of the half key, thereby preventing the half key from being dislocated or floating up during operation. The distance between the limiting bolts and the top of the half key can be adjusted to facilitate adaptation to different operation scenes.
[0009] As a further improvement of the utility model, the limiting bolt is threadedly connected with a locking nut on the main body on the top of the support.
[0010] The locking nut can further fix the limiting bolt, avoiding the loosening of the limiting bolt caused by the impact of the half-split key.
